eric6/Project/ProjectTranslationsBrowser.py

changeset 7836
2f0d208b8137
parent 7785
9978016560ec
child 7907
7991ea245c20
child 7924
8a96736d465e
--- a/eric6/Project/ProjectTranslationsBrowser.py	Sat Nov 21 19:31:16 2020 +0100
+++ b/eric6/Project/ProjectTranslationsBrowser.py	Sun Nov 22 16:04:59 2020 +0100
@@ -818,7 +818,7 @@
                             pf.write('\n\n')
                 
                 self.__tmpProjects.append(outFile)
-            except IOError:
+            except OSError:
                 E5MessageBox.critical(
                     self,
                     self.tr("Write temporary project file"),
@@ -959,7 +959,7 @@
                     self.__tmpProjects.remove(
                         self.__pylupdateProcesses[index][1])
                     os.remove(self.__pylupdateProcesses[index][1])
-                except EnvironmentError:
+                except OSError:
                     pass
                 del self.__pylupdateProcesses[index]
                 break
@@ -1065,7 +1065,7 @@
                 try:
                     self.__tmpProjects.remove(tempProjectFile)
                     os.remove(tempProjectFile)
-                except EnvironmentError:
+                except OSError:
                     pass
         
     def __generateAll(self):

eric ide

mercurial